WebNine Gems (Navratna) of Akbar's Court. Name. Points to remember. Abul Fazl. He was the chronicler of Akbar's rule. He authored Akbar's biography - Akbarnama. Abul Fazl documented the history meticulously over a period of seven years. Faizi. Faizi translated the Panchatantra, the Ramayana and the Mahabharata into Persian.

One of the nine jewels in the court of Mughal emperor Akbar, Tansen (1500 – 1586), was one of the greatest Indian musicians.

WebTansen is considered as one of the greatest composer-musicians in Indian classical music. Web27 feb. 2024 · The nine jewels, according to popular belief are: Abul Fazl, Abdul Rahim Khan-I-Khana, Birbal, Mulla Do-Piyaza, Faizi, Raja Man Singh, Raja Todar Mal, Faqir … WebOne of the nine jewels (navaratnas) at Mughal emperor Akbar’s court — Mian Tansen is considered to be a pioneer of Indian classical music. His ragas are an important part of Indian culture and many of them contain the prefix, “mian ki”. For example, “Mian ki Todi” or “Mian ki Malhar” Pilgrimage In India Music Painting Indian Music
